From what I can tell Ring Doorbells have issues with TP Link Mesh networks. I have a replacement Doorbell on the way but I don’t think it will solve the problem. I have set my Deco M5 network to send notifications when my Ring Doorbell connects and disconnects. On average it connects and disconnects every 2-3 minutes. Sometime multiples times with in a minute. I have tried a guest network set to only 2.4Ghz with beamforming on/off and fast roaming on/off and Mesh on/off on the device only.

I have since created a new wifi network with an old TP Link router and the connection seems to be stable. My conclusion is Ring + TP Link Mesh = FAIL

I have the same issue in that it works great for a while (usually around 30 days) and then disconnects. Usual error notification is that my router is too far away and cannot Ring cannot reconnect.

After numerous calls to Ring Support I finally got someone on the line that was knowledgeable and honest! The lady said that when the Ring (Have Ring 3 plus) updates it firmware, it then disconnects from the internet and it is unable to reconnect to TP Link networks. So every time they send firmware update notice to the doorbell, it updates and then drops. Only way to address is to remove faceplate, remove battery (orange set up button doesn’t work) and then re-setup. Minor time investment now that I know how to fix, but would be nice if Ring would address the issue. Oh well, not getting a new wifi as the other 50 wifi connections in the house work perfectly…
